茗: Fragrant tea, a symbol of refined living. Often used in names, it represents a life of comfort and beauty, embodying auspiciousness, health, and smooth success.
皓: Pure and radiant. In names, it often conveys the meaning of a broad-minded, elegant, and noble character.
Meaning: Ming refers to tea, symbolizing freshness and elegance; Hao means pure and bright, signifying integrity and noble character.
